FAQs

Cloud Atlas is undoubtedly a complex film due to its non-linear structure and the multitude of characters and storylines it juggles. The narrative jumps between six distinct eras, and the same actors often appear in different guises, which can initially be disorienting. However, the directors weave these threads together with a clear thematic throughline and recurring motifs, encouraging viewers to embrace the journey. Patience and an openness to its ambitious scope are rewarded with a rich and interconnected viewing experience, rather than a straightforward plot.
